Userlike
Userlike

Description: Userlike is a customer service software that provides live chat, email support, knowledge base, and analytics. It allows businesses to communicate with customers in real-time via chat widgets on their website.

Userlike
Userlike Features
  • Live Chat
  • Email Support
  • Knowledge Base
  • Analytics
  • Chatbots
  • Team Inboxes
  • Canned Responses
